Features and Controls
Using the Navigation System
This section presents basic information to operate the
navigation system.
Use the hard keys located on the navigation system
along with the available touch screen buttons on the
navigation screen to operate the system. See Navigation
System Overview on page 1-2 for more information.
Once the vehicle is moving, various functions will be
disabled to reduce driver distractions.
Hard Keys
The following hard keys are located on the navigation
system:
X (Open/Close Faceplate): Press this key located at
the bottom of the Navigation Screen to open or close
the faceplate.
XB (Eject CD): Press the eject CD key next to
the CD loading slot to eject CDs. See CD Player
on page 3-14 for more information.
X DVD (Eject Map Database DVD): Press the eject
DVD key next to the DVD loading slot to eject the
map DVD. See “Installing the Map DVD” under Maps on
page 2-49 for more information.
Power/Volume Knob: Press the power/volume knob to
turn the audio and navigation systems on and off.
Turn the knob to increase or decrease the volume to
the audio system.
g (Voice Recognition): Press this key to activate the
voice recognition system. See Voice Recognition on
page 4-2 for more information.
NAV (Navigation): Press this key to access the map
screen. If this key is pressed when a map screen
is displayed and you are in route guidance, the system
will repeat the last voice command.
SRCE (Source): Press this key to access the audio
source screen. See Navigation Audio System on
page 3-2.
e/ z (Audio/Screen Adjust): Press this key to
access the Audio Adjust and Screen Adjust screens.
See Navigation Audio System on page 3-2.
QO SEEKR(Seek/Tune): Press the seek/tune
arrows to go to the next or previous radio station and
stay there, or to tune in a station. See Navigation Audio
System on page 3-2.
